CHALK PAINT and Easy Crackle by Artisan Enhancements

A simple transformation using CHALK PAINT® and Artisan Enhancements Easy Crackle.

We found this vase at a thrift store and purchased it for its practical use - to hold silks.  But we were looking for more of a Holiday look to be used with very blingy white silks. 

The base color was perfect, but it needed to be toned down and more festive looking. The transformation was so easy!  First a coat of Artisan Enhancements Easy Crackle was applied over the vase.  Once thoroughly dry we applied Old White CHALK PAINT® and watched the magic crackle begin.  It crackled all over beautifully, showing the base coppery color perfectly muted with the White over it.  After it was dry, we applied a thin coat of wax.  Really, that's it.  Basically three steps to transform a vase using CHALK PAINT® and Easy Crackle.

Lamp Transformation and a few pieces from a BRING A PIECE Class

We came across this lamp awhile back.  The bones were great but the style - not so much.  Working with Chalk Paint® and Artisan Enhancement products we transformed it from a shiny glass lamp into one that looks much like cement.  

The Before


The during - here the first coat of Fine Stone has been applied to the lamp.  Let throughly dry before going on to the next step which was Crackle Tex and then Old White Chalk Paint® using a pull off technique.

And, the After!  Several steps were used in this transformation, Chalk Paint® colors were Country Grey and Old White, Artisan Enhancement Fine Stone, Crackle Tex, final step was Soft Clear Wax then Soft Dark Wax.


It looks very much like stone!
